Ingredients:
- 4 medium firm pears (Bosc or Anjou), halved and cored
- 1/2 tsp ground cinnamon
- 1/4 tsp ground nutmeg
- 4 tbsp honey
- 2 tbsp unsalted butter, melted
- 1 tsp vanilla extract
- 1 pinch sea salt
- 1/4 cup chopped walnuts
Instructions:
- Preheat your oven to 375°F (190°C). Carefully slice the pears in half lengthwise. Use a melon baller or pairing knife to remove the center seeds, creating a small well. Arrange them cut-side up in a 9x13 inch baking dish and dust the tops evenly with cinnamon and nutmeg.
- In a small bowl, whisk together the melted butter, honey, vanilla extract, and salt until the mixture is smooth and emulsified.
- Spoon the honey mixture generously into the center of each pear, allowing some to drizzle down the sides. Scatter the chopped walnuts over the top.
- Bake for 25–30 minutes until the pears are tender when pierced with a fork and the honey is bubbling and a deep golden brown.
